The Tale of a Young Wizard
--------
Steven and Gregory approached the already gathering group of first years at the steps, along with the other slytherins, they made up the rear of the group. Gregory decided to spark up come conversation about Steven's family.
"Indoval isn't a pure-blood family, is it?"
"Erm...no, I guess it isn't. My parents are muggles...so far as I know, why?"
"That's a shame...a real shame..."
"What? What's wrong?"
"Slytherin house doesn't except anyone but pure-bloods. Slytherin is the elite of Hogwarts, the pride of the wizarding world, and muggle-borns are not the pride of our world...shame too, you would've made a good Slytherin."
He felt rejected, up until this point he had been completly content with this new world, but now, the only people who he had found acceptance with in his entire life, he could not be friends with. He was crushed, he was alone again. Gregory and his group of slytherins continued walking with the rest of the first years, ignoring Steven's presence now, ignoring that he had stayed where he was. He didn't want to move, he didn't want to keep going.
"Wha'r you doin' ere? Ye ought tuh be wif the first years up there, ge' along now" A strong, soft voice said from behind him. He turned and was head to thigh with the biggest person he'd ever seen. The man must have been able to tell he was shocked. "My names Hagrid, nice ter meet ya" the half-giant said, extending his large hand to little Steven. He shook his hand, rather meekly, then the man let out an excited laugh and led Steven back to Professor McGonagall and the other first years.
"This'n got lost Minerva, an I don't reckon he's ever seen a half-giant bafore neither"
"Well, I'm sure he's been touched by his meeting with you, for the better or worse I'm not so sure..." she grinned at him and he returned her sarcasm with a loud laugh, patting her on the back, nearly knocking the wind out of her, before he continued to the great hall.
"Now children, you are about to be sorted by the Hogwarts Sorting Hat, it will look inside you and find out which of the four houses fits you best, if you want power and acceptance, Slytherin will be your defense, if you are brave and loyal, Gryffindor will make you royal, if you are wise and cunning, Ravenclaw will find you stunning, and if you are kind and caring, Hufflepuff will find you dashing. So come in, and welcome, to Hogwarts, School for Witches and Wizards." And with that, she pushed open the doors to the great hall, and ushered the first years in, their eyes popping out of their heads in awe at the scenery around them, the life-like enchanted ceiling, the 4 huge tables, the decorations of the four houses, and in the very back, the teachers. Steven couldn't help but notice one seat next to Dumbledore which was empty, and in the middle of all this, was a stool, which sat a raggidy old hat.
One by one, first year students were called by Professor McGonagall to come forward to the hat.
Johnathen Stevenski! The boy who had been forced to dance by Gregory..Gryffindor!
Gregory von Stein! And there was Gregory, no doubt where he'd end up...Slytherin!
Amanda Stevenski! One of the other kids Gregory had tormented, must be Johnathen's sister...Hufflepuff!
Tyler Gordon! He was one of the kids with Gregory...Ravenclaw! He looked over to see the look of shock and disbelief on Gregory's face. He couldn't help but smirk.
Steven's heart jumped into his throat when he saw the next first year. Sabrina Bolzar! Brown hair...hazel eyes...she looked so much like the girl in his dream...Slytherin!
No...he thought, I won't be in Slytherin...and the girl I dreamed about is...it's not fair...
Steven Indoval! He was snapped out of his thoughts by his own name being shouted above the hall. He slowly stepped forward from the very back of the first years, and sat down under the hat. He could hear its voice entering his head..
Alot of pain in your life...alot of sadness...you're lonely...you want acceptance...but what you want most..is power..your family has fallen out of favor...you can restore glory to the Indoval family...check the library sometime..old Swedish houses...
One word snapped through his thoughts and hushed the hall...
Slytherin!! He couldn't believe it, he couldn't help but let out a big sigh of relief, as he ran to the cheering Slytherin table and took his seat, next to Gregory, who was suddenly friendly again, and right across from the brunette...
"Hi" he said, barely audible.
She returned his greeting with a smile, and returned to her plate..and Steven hung his head in embarassment..
